David reminded the Realtors that 80% of FSBOs eventually use a Realtor.
The Realtor who gets the listing is the one who has built a “relationship”
and shows his willingness to be there—just “show up!” And, leave behind
“Tips for Selling Your Home.” His theory is this: “My gosh, if this Realtor
is working this hard, and does not have my listing, what can I expect
when he/she does?
And, he advises just stopping by in the neighborhood to see how things
are going, NOT trying to sign them up after the first two weeks. David
Knox says that the stats show that most FSBOs are ready to list after
8-10 weeks—of paying for those newspaper ads, getting the house cleaned
up and ready, and staying home for 8 weekends in a row, rather than enjoying
their hobbies and families.
So, if you have not explored the wonderful world of FSBOs and Expireds,
now might be the time, if your market is slim on listing inventory. Show
up and Be There! Chief reason for getting the Listing: consistent follow-up
system.

He introduced the importance of the Wheel in creating balance in your
life and inviting participants to review their level of satisfaction in
areas of Financial (Business, Retirement, Wealth), Personal (Health, Well-Being,
Recreation) Relationships (Connections, Family, Friends), and Balance
(Happiness, Spirituality). He also highlighted the importance of Clarity—Alignment—Action
in helping individuals achieve the best within themselves. And, highlighting
the importance of living and aligning their actions with their core value
system.
